I have an old Sears 'Proformance' Model # 562.93300350 Cassette Deck that I'm trying to get working again. There are two belt's inside the unit. One is what I call the main drive belt..it's approx.1/4" wide x 1/16" thick..but I haven't removed it yet,so I don't know the length, then there's another smaller belt that comes off a pulley that goes over and drives the tape counter. I've contacted sears parts direct..but to be honest, they don't seem to have a clue about what I'm needing. On their online diagram, it doesn't even show the 'main' drive belt. I wish someone could help me locate one so I could repair my deck and enjoy my tape's again. On the back of the unit, it states ' Made In Japan'..and as we all know, Sears doesn't make ANYTHING !

The discrepancy arises between what Sears Parts Direct identify as 'Main' and what you are calling 'main.'

Flat belt is probably a Capstan belt and the square ('Main') belt would be the counter belt.

Once they have been removed and ACCURATELY measured, there are still many sites that sell flat and square drive belts. Your basic problems then are availability of 'correct' sizes (realize that your belts are quite likely stretched, and that at this late date, what's left in a sites' inventory is a shadow of what they probably carried in the past). You may have to get one that is smaller/thinner or thicker and narrower or wider than the original.
Also, many sites are charging outrageously inflated prices. In the hay day of generic belts, price range was 25 cents for the smallest up to 3 or 4 dollars for the largest.
